Biodiversity and Coastline Protection
The Damas Island Estuary, where the Mangrove Kayaking Adventure takes place, is a crucial biodiversity hotspot that plays a vital role in coastline protection and marine health.
The intricate network of mangrove roots and canals supports a diverse array of wildlife, including monkeys, caiman, iguanas, and exotic birds.
This delicate ecosystem acts as a natural barrier, shielding the coastline from erosion and storms, while also filtering and purifying the water, benefiting the overall marine environment.
